Ratio Explanation:

This ratio may reflect competitive transport of n-acetyl-isoputreanine and phenylacetylcarnitine by SLC22A1, an organic cation transporter.1[1], 2[2]

Ratio Evidence:

metabolites related through biology

Gene Ratio Phenotype Relationship:

Altered SLC22A1 function likely impacts the transport of both metabolites and influences hepatic lipid metabolism, leading to hypercholesterolemia and lipoprotein disorders.8[1], 9[2], 10[3] Reduced SLC22A1 function is associated with higher total and LDL cholesterol.8[4], 9[5]
